diff --git a/internal/user.go b/internal/user.go index c6f9f7d..9ae5729 100644 --- a/internal/user.go +++ b/internal/user.go @@ -60,7 +60,7 @@ func GetUserFavoritesCount(ctx context.Context, driver neo4j.DriverWithContext, var userFavoriteCount int64 query := ` - MATCH (userNode:User {user_id: anthrove_user_id}) + MATCH (userNode:User {user_id: $anthrove_user_id}) MATCH (userNode)-[:FAV]->(favPost:AnthrovePost) MATCH (sourceNode)-[:REFERENCE]->(favPost) RETURN count(favPost) AS FavoritePostsCount @@ -100,7 +100,7 @@ func GetUserSourceLink(ctx context.Context, driver neo4j.DriverWithContext, anth userSource := make(map[string]models.AnthroveUserRelationship) query := ` - MATCH (user:User{user_id: anthrove_user_id})-[r:HAS_ACCOUNT_AT]->(s:Source) + MATCH (user:User{user_id: $anthrove_user_id})-[r:HAS_ACCOUNT_AT]->(s:Source) RETURN toString(r.user_id) AS sourceUserID, toString(r.username) AS sourceUsername, s.display_name as sourceDisplayName; ` params := map[string]any{